WebOct 15, 2004 · However, spin etch planarization, a process developed by Levert et al. at SEZ America Inc. [43] is based on the principles of controlled chemical etching of metals. During SEP, the wafer is suspended horizontally on a nitrogen cushion above a rotating chuck (Fig. 12). The substrate is held in place laterally with locking pins on the wafer edge.
